Billie Eilish Says She Lost 100,000 Followers After Posting Picture Of 'Big Boobs'

Billie Eilish says she lost 100,000 followers after showing off her new look as 'people are scared of big boobs'.

Ahead of the release of her new album Happier Than Ever, the 19-year-old started to change up her usual look - swapping her green locks and baggy clothes for a platinum barnet and more experimental fashion choices.

And while some fans absolutely loved her new look - a post of her Vogue front cover became the fastest Instagram post to hit a million likes at the time - some were not happy and showed their distaste by unfollowing her account.

Speaking to Elle, Eilish said: "People hold on to these memories and have an attachment.

"But it's very dehumanising."

Speaking about a recent Instagram post of her wearing a corset, the singer continued: "I lost 100,000 followers, just because of the boobs.

"People are scared of big boobs."

She went on to talk about how she is constantly scrutinised for how she chooses to dress.

Eilish told the publication: "The other day, I decided to wear a tank top. It wasn't even a provocative shirt.

"But I know people are going to say, 'Holy f***, she's dressing sexy and trying to make a statement.'

"And I'm like, 'No, I'm not. It's 500 degrees and I just want to wear a tank top.' "

This isn't the first time the teen has hit back at body shamers who try and criticise what she wears.

During her interview for British Vogue - which saw Eilish don a corset and a Burberry trench coat - she said: "If you're about body positivity, why would you wear a corset? Why wouldn't you show your actual body?

"My thing is that I can do whatever I want. It's all about what makes you feel good. If you want to get surgery, go get surgery.

"If you want to wear a dress that somebody thinks that you look too big wearing, f*** it - if you feel like you look good, you look good."

She went on to point out that she - and other women - can be harshly judged for how they choose to dress.

She continued: "Suddenly, you're a hypocrite if you want to show your skin, and you're easy, and you're a slut.

"If I am, then I'm proud. Me and all the girls are hoes, and f*** it, y'know? Let's turn it around and be empowered in that.

"Showing your body and showing your skin - or not - should not take any respect away from you."
